Ingredients
To whip up this easy loaded fries recipe, you’ll need the following ingredients:
Core Ingredients
- Fries: 1 bag (frozen or homemade)
- Cheddar Cheese: 2 cups, shredded
- Cooked Bacon: 1 cup, crumbled
- Green Onions: ½ cup, chopped
- Sour Cream: 1 cup
- Jalapeños: ¼ cup, sliced (optional for that spicy kick!)
Optional Toppings
- Guacamole: for a creamy twist
- Chili: for hearty warmth
- Olives: for a salty punch
- Pico de Gallo: fresh and zesty
Instructions
Creating these delicious loaded fries is easier than you think! Follow these simple steps to achieve the best loaded fries recipe.
-
Prepare the Fries:
- If you’re using frozen fries, bake or fry them according to package instructions until golden brown and crispy.
- If you’re feeling adventurous, you can make your own homemade fries from scratch!
-
Layer with Cheese:
- Once the fries are cooked and hot, transfer them to an oven-safe dish or baking tray.
- Generously s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ese over the fries.
-
Load Up:
- Sprinkle crumbled bacon and sliced jalapeños over the cheese-covered fries.
-
Melt and Broil:
- Place the loaded fries in the oven on low broil for about 3-5 minutes, or until the cheese is beautifully melted and bubbly. Keep an eye on them so they don’t burn!
-
Garnish:
- Remove from the oven and top with chopped green onions and a dollop of sour cream. Feel free to get creative with additional toppings!
-
Serve Immediately:
- Enjoy your delicious creation with friends and family.
Tips & Variations
Here are some pro tips and fun variations to make your loaded fries even more special:
Pro Tips
- Texture Matters: For the best results, choose fries that are thick and sturdy so they can hold all those toppings!
- Customize It: You can alternate between different types of cheese or even add barbecue sauce for a smoky twist.
Variations
- Meat-Lovers Loaded Fries: Add cooked ground beef or pulled pork for an irresistible meaty flavor.
- Spicy Loaded Fries: Add extra jalapeños and a drizzle of hot sauce for spice lovers.
- Vegetarian Loaded Fries: Swap bacon for black beans or sautéed mushrooms for a delicious veggie option.
